-- This script automatically loads playlist entries before and after the
|
|
-- the currently played file. It does so by scanning the directory a file is
|
|
-- located in when starting playback. It sorts the directory entries
|
|
-- alphabetically, and adds entries before and after the current file to
|
|
-- the internal playlist. (It stops if it would add an already existing
|
|
-- playlist entry at the same position - this makes it "stable".)
|
|
-- Add at most 5000 * 2 files when starting a file (before + after).
|
|
|
|
--[[
|
|
To configure this script use file autoload.conf in directory script-opts (the "script-opts"
|
|
directory must be in the mpv configuration directory, typically ~/.config/mpv/).
|
|
|
|
Option `ignore_patterns` is a comma-separated list of patterns (see lua.org/pil/20.2.html).
|
|
Additionally to the standard lua patterns, you can also escape commas with `%`,
|
|
for example, the option `bak%,x%,,another` will be resolved as patterns `bak,x,` and `another`.
|
|
But it does not mean you need to escape all lua patterns twice,
|
|
so the option `bak%%,%。mp4,` will be resolved as two patterns `bak%%` and `%.mp4`.
|
|
|
|
Example configuration would be:
|
|
|
|
disabled=no
|
|
images=no
|
|
videos=yes
|
|
audio=yes
|
|
additional_image_exts=list,of,ext
|
|
additional_video_exts=list,of,ext
|
|
additional_audio_exts=list,of,ext
|
|
ignore_hidden=yes
|
|
same_type=yes
|
|
same_series=yes
|
|
directory_mode=recursive
|
|
ignore_patterns=^~,^bak-,%.bak$
|
|
|
|
--]]
